What is a 5 Axis CNC Machine?

A 5 axis CNC machine is a type of CNC machine that is capable of moving in five different directions. This allows the machine to produce complex parts with intricate details. The five axes of motion are X, Y, Z, A, and B. The X and Y axes are the traditional linear axes, while the Z axis is the vertical axis. The A and B axes are rotary axes that allow the machine to rotate the part in two different directions.

Factors to Consider When Choosing a 5 Axis CNC Machine

When selecting a 5 axis CNC machine, there are several factors to consider. These include the size of the machine, the type of materials it can work with, the accuracy and precision of the machine, and the cost.

Size

The size of the 5 axis CNC machine is an important factor to consider. The size of the machine will determine the size of the parts it can produce. If you are looking to produce large parts, then you will need a larger machine. On the other hand, if you are looking to produce small parts, then you will need a smaller machine.

Materials

The type of materials the 5 axis CNC machine can work with is also an important factor to consider. Different materials require different cutting tools and speeds. Make sure the machine you choose is capable of working with the materials you plan to use.

Accuracy and Precision

The accuracy and precision of the 5 axis CNC machine is also an important factor to consider. The accuracy and precision of the machine will determine the quality of the parts it produces. Make sure the machine you choose is capable of producing parts with the accuracy and precision you require.

Cost

The cost of the 5 axis CNC machine is also an important factor to consider. The cost of the machine will depend on the size, materials, accuracy, and precision of the machine. Make sure you get the best value for your money by comparing prices and features of different machines.
